Historical Events on December 8

Date Event
1941 World War II: U.S. President Franklin D. Roosevelt declares December 7 to be "a date which will live in infamy", after which the U.S. declares war on Japan.
1998 Eighty-one people are killed by armed groups in Algeria.
1955 The Flag of Europe is adopted by Council of Europe.
2004 The Cusco Declaration is signed in Cusco, Peru, establishing the South American Community of Nations.
1922 Two days after coming into existence, the Irish Free State executes four leaders of the Irish Republican Army.
2010 The Japanese solar-sail spacecraft IKAROS passes the planet Venus at a distance of about 80,800 km.
1953 U.S. President Dwight D. Eisenhower delivers his "Atoms for Peace" speech, which leads to an American program to supply equipment and information on nuclear power to schools, hospitals, and research institutions around the world.
1987 Cold War: The Intermediate-Range Nuclear Forces Treaty is signed by U.S. President Ronald Reagan and Soviet leader Mikhail Gorbachev in the White House.
1971 Indo-Pakistani War: The Indian Navy launches an attack on West Pakistan's port city of Karachi.
2019 First confirmed case of COVID-19 in China.
